Transaxle

Special Tool(s):




Material:





Installation (Steps 1-22)

1. Make sure that the torque converter is installed correctly.

2. NOTE: Lubricate the torque converter pilot hub with multi-purpose grease.





Check the installation depth of the torque converter.
1 Lay a steel straightedge on the automatic transaxle flange.
2 Check the installation depth between the transaxle flange and the torque converter centering spigot for the correct clearance.
3. Using a high-lift jack, secure the transaxle using a safety strap.





4. Remove the special tool.

5. NOTE: Make sure that the dowel pins are installed in the engine block prior to installing the transaxle.

Move the transaxle into position.

6. NOTE: Note the location of the different length bolts.





Install the 3 front torque converter housing bolts.
^ Tighten to 47 Nm (35 ft. lbs.).





7. Install the 3 rear converter housing bolts.
^ Tighten to 47 Nm (35 ft. lbs.).
8. Remove the transmission jack.





9. Install the bracket and the nut on the torque converter housing stud.
^ Tighten to 25 Nm (18 ft. lbs.).

10. CAUTION: Rotate the engine in a clockwise direction only or engine damage will occur.

NOTE: Install new self-locking nuts only.





Install new torque converter nuts.
^ Tighten to 37 Nm (27 ft. lbs.).





11. Connect the transmission fluid cooler hoses to the transmission.





12. Position the starter in place and install the 2 bolts.
^ Tighten to 35 Nm (26 ft. lbs.).





13. Install the wiring harness fastener on the starter stud.





14. Install the starter terminals and install the boot back into position.
1 Tighten to 12 Nm (9 ft. lbs.).
2 Tighten to 5 Nm (44 inch lbs.).
15. Position the subframe in place using a suitable powertrain lift.

16. NOTE: LH shown, RH similar. Install the front subframe nuts.





^ Tighten to 150 Nm (111 ft. lbs.).





17. Position the subframe support brackets in place and loosely install the bolts.





18. Install the rear subframe nuts.
^ Tighten to 150 Nm (111 ft. lbs.).





19. Tighten the subframe support bracket bolts.
^ Tighten to 103 Nm (76 ft. lbs.).
20. Install the LH and RH halfshafts.

21. NOTE: LH shown, RH similar.





Install the sway bar links and nuts to the struts.
^ Tighten to 40 Nm (30 ft. lbs.).





22. Position the steering gear in place and install the bolts.
^ Tighten to 107 Nm (79 ft. lbs.).
